Abstract :
This research aims to determine the wood ash ash filler using the Marshall method, and to determine the optimum asphalt content produced in concrete asphalt mixtures using wood ash ash fillers, in terms of stability marshall, flow, VIM (voids In Mix), VMA (Void In Mineral Aggregate), VFB (Void Filled Bitumen), and Marshall quotient (MQ). The method of concrete asphalt mixture in this study uses AC 60/70 asphalt. Each study used different asphalt levels, namely: 4%, 5%, 6%, 7%, 7.5%. With each sample consisting of 3 test sample variants. This research was conducted at the Laboratory of Engineering, the university attended. The stages of the study included coarse coral aggregate suspended by sieve no. 8 (2,36mm), fine aggregate of sand by passing filter no. 8 (2,36mm), and the filler uses firewood ash to pass filter no. 200 (0.075mm). Test results from this study on Marshall characteristics obtained Optimum Asphalt content of 6% with a Stability average value of 1757, a mean flow value of 2.9 mm, a mean VIM (voids in mix) value of 5.60%, a mean value of VMA (Void In Mineral Agregate) 20.22%, average VFB (Void Filled Bitumen) value 71.81%, and Marshall quotient (MQ) average value of 522 kg/mm.
